Family Programs - Western Communities Action Network - WeCAN
Provides the follwing services: - Adopt a Family: A holiday giving program connecting low-income families with anonymous sponsors that provide the families with gifts and necessities ?- Birthday Shelf: Gifts and party supplies to celebrate a child's birthday - Personal Hygiene: Personal hygiene items and cleaning supplies given out once per month to stretch budgets - Pet Food Assistance: Pet food available once per month if needed - Ready to Learn: School supplies and backpacks for children in grades K-12

Application process
Must fill out an intake form and live in the service area
Required documents
Application/registration form; drivers license; proof of income; piece of mail or utility bill post marked within the last 30 days
Eligibility
Serves low incomes residents living in Greenfield, Independence, Loretto, Maple Plain, Minnetonka Beach, Minnetrista, Mound, western Orono, Rockford, Spring Park, Saint Bonifacius, and Tonka Bay
